Sugar daddy sites have emerged as an alternative, promising a different kind of arrangement. Typically, they connect older, wealthier individuals (the sugar daddies or mommies) with younger companions (sugar babies) who seek both emotional and financial support. For many, these platforms present a straightforward concept: mutual benefits. The sugar daddy offers financial assistance or luxury experiences, while the sugar baby brings youth, charm, and companionship to the table.
The Role of Financial Dynamics
One of the most fascinating shifts here is how money plays a role in relationships. Traditional romance often operated under the guise of “love conquers all.” Yet, there’s an undeniable practicality that comes with the concept of sugar daddy sites. Relationships based on financial support remove a lot of the ambiguity that often clouds traditional dating. The agreement is clear: you offer companionship, and in return, you receive support.
This shift might make us uncomfortable, and that’s okay. Many of us grew up with romantic ideals that suggest true love blossoms in spontaneity and emotional connection alone. But the realities of student loans, rising rent prices, and the cost of living invite a fresh perspective on what partnership can look like. Many sugar babies liken their experiences to having mentorship opportunities, along with the financial benefits.
